Refractory Period
A time right after stimulation when a nerve or muscle cannot respond to additional stimulation.
Neuronal Membrane
The phospholipid bilayer that encases a neuron, allowing for the regulation of ion flow necessary for transmitting nerve impulses.
Sodium
A chemical element, symbol Na, that is a soft, silvery-white, highly reactive metal and is used in various compounds and biological functions.
Synaptic Cleft
The tiny gap between neurons at a synapse, through which neurotransmitters are released to transmit nerve impulses from one neuron to another.
